Azerbaijan's participation in EU programs discussed

By Sara Rajabova

The meeting of the Council of European Union held in Luxembourg on April 14 adopted several decisions on Azerbaijan's participation in EU programs, the organization said.

The Council adopted decisions on the signing, provisional application and conclusion of a protocol to the EU-Azerbaijan Partnership and Cooperation Agreement concerning a Framework Agreement between the EU and Azerbaijan on general principles for the participation of Azerbaijan in Union programs.

On June 22, 1999 Partnership and Cooperation Agreement (signed on April 22, 1996 in Luxemburg) between the EU member-states and Azerbaijan entered into force, thus signifying a higher level of cooperation between EU countries and Azerbaijan.

The objectives of the agreement is to provide an appropriate framework for the political dialogue between the parties allowing the development of political relations, to support Azerbaijan's efforts to consolidate its democracy and to develop its economy and to complete the transition into a market economy and to promote trade and investment and harmonious economic, social, financial, scientific, technological and cultural cooperation.
